
BMW 1 Series118i M Sport 5dr Step Auto
2020
23,510 miles
Petrol
£19,702
ME207UB
£19,702
£34,490
£1,491 off£27,692
£30,990
£22,950
£28,100
£28,790
£800 off£29,995
£31,402
£800 off£12,695
£32,450
£1,000 off£46,625
£22,227
£21,491
£1,496 off£27,991
£25,492
£20,502
£21,530
343-360 of 532 vehicles